how do i connect to maemo channel on freenode?
 
ok, newbie here,

i figured out how to connect to the irc.freenode.net server and register. but i can't connect to the maemo channel or even find it.

what is the way that i can do this on pidgin or even on a desktop?

there are no EXPLICIT LINE BY LINE instructions anywhere that i can see and have looked for an hour or more.

one thing i don't understand stand is whether i type in irc.freenode.net and then add the maemo channel later -- or if I should type in the exact maemo server (which I couldn't figure out)

I tried variations like maemo.freenode.net, irc.freenode.net#maemo and irc.freenode.net/#maemo but no luck

thanks in advance,

repoman

jaem 2009-09-18 23:56

Re: how do i connect to maemo channel on freenode?
 
I don't have a link on hand, but Googling "irc tutorial" should give you lots of results. IRC is mostly a command-line style interface. Presuming you're using Pidgin, XChat, or something else that has a GUI for accounts, and you're already connected, just type
/join #channel-name
a '/' at the beginning of a line denotes an IRC command

EDIT: #maemo's a pretty friendly place, but you'll probably want to read up on IRC usage and etiquette before you head out into that area of the Internet, as some people/channels don't take kindly to ignorance, just because they're jerks, and there are plenty of unintentional faux pas that are easy to commit.
